The single main leaf is likely warped out of shape or twisted.

 

Swap the 620 springs in there. This will raise the ride height though. You could maybe remove one of the lower leaves without seriously hurting the ride. This will limit the load you can carry but I doubt this is a problem for you.

 

 

 

 

 

 

tire profiles don't look the same? even though they may be the same size the sidewall profiles can be different!

 

Maybe. Different rims could also cause this. Swap sides and see if there is a change.
